can you use synthetic oil in 2006 grand cherokee with 5.7 litre engine?

I changed oil in my 2006 v-8 5.7 litre engine and used synthetic oil and special filter and now the check engine symbol is on.

Changing from regular to synthetic should not cause engine light to come on,unless you used a thinner grade oil,have the code,s pulled to no the real issue.

You can change to synthetic oil anytime, just make sure you follow the manufacturers recommendations on viscosity.

Did you reset the oil service interval warning when you changed the oil ?
